AI-designed viruses test biosecurity limits
Scientists used artificial intelligence to design complete genetic instructions for bacteriophages, and some of the computer-generated designs produced working viruses when built and tested in the lab, marking a significant milestone in biological engineering. The viruses were designed to infect E. coli bacteria, not humans, and the AI model Evo 2 was trained with safety restrictions that excluded viruses infecting animals, plants, and humans. Despite this, the experiment raises concerns about whether biosecurity safeguards can keep pace with AI's growing ability to design biological systems. Bacteriophages could potentially treat antibiotic-resistant infections, but the technology also poses biosecurity challenges. Safeguards include screening DNA orders, laboratory oversight, and international preparedness, though countries vary significantly in their capabilities to detect and respond to biological threats.
